MW56 HSG is a 2007 Saab 9-3 Vector Sport Tid in Grey with a 1,910c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 19 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 68.4%.
Across all 2007 Saab 9-3 Vector Sport Tid models, the average MOT pass rate is 75.4% with a typical mileage of 103,205 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Saab 9-3 Vector Sport Tid f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 268 recorded failures. If you're considering buying MW56 HSG,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Saab 9-3 Vector Sport Tid typically stays on UK roads for around 22 years. At 19 years old, this Saab 9-3 Vector Sport Tid is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
